Understanding Excavator-Mounted Crushing and Screening
Before diving into specific materials, it is important to understand how these tools work together.
Excavator mounted crushing and screening systems use attachments fitted directly to excavators. A bucket crusher handles material reduction, while a screening bucket separates material by size. Together, they create a mobile processing setup capable of handling mixed and challenging materials without additional machines.
This setup is widely used for construction and demolition material recycling, helping contractors reduce costs, increase efficiency, and improve sustainability.
Concrete
One of the Most Common Materials Processed
Concrete is the most widely processed material using bucket crushers. Demolition waste from buildings, sidewalks, foundations, and slabs can be crushed directly on-site.
Using bucket crushers for concrete and asphalt, contractors can:
- Reduce concrete into reusable aggregate
- Eliminate hauling to recycling facilities
- Reuse crushed material for backfill or road base
- Lower disposal and material purchase costs
Concrete processed with bucket crushers is ideal for:
- Trench backfill
- Subbase layers
- Temporary access roads
- Landscaping fill
Asphalt
Asphalt is another material well suited for bucket crushers. Road milling projects, parking lot removals, and pavement repairs generate large amounts of asphalt that can be reused.
By processing asphalt on-site:
- Material can be reused immediately
- Costs for new aggregate are reduced
- Projects move faster without waiting for deliveries
Crushed asphalt is commonly reused in:
- Road base construction
- Temporary road surfaces
- Site stabilization
Brick and Masonry
Brick, block, and masonry materials are often mixed with concrete in demolition projects. Bucket crushers are capable of processing these materials efficiently.
Crushed brick and masonry can be reused for:
- Backfill
- Landscaping applications
- Non-structural fill
- Drainage layers
This makes them a valuable component of materials processed with bucket crushers on renovation and demolition sites.
Natural Stone and Rock
Natural stone and rock from excavation or site preparation can also be processed using bucket crushers.
Common applications include:
- Reducing oversized rock from excavation
- Creating usable aggregate from site material
- Processing stone for subbase or fill
This capability is especially useful in remote areas where importing aggregate is expensive or impractical.
Mixed Construction and Demolition Waste
Many job sites generate mixed materials that include concrete, brick, stone, and soil. Bucket crushers excel in these conditions because they can handle inconsistent feed material.
When combined with screening buckets, mixed material can be separated into usable fractions, supporting construction and demolition material recycling without the need for sorting facilities.
Soil and Excavated Material
While bucket crushers focus on material reduction, screening buckets play a key role in processing soil.
Screening Buckets Material Applications for Soil
Screening buckets can:
- Separate topsoil from debris
- Remove rocks and roots
- Improve soil consistency
- Prepare material for reuse
Screened soil is commonly reused for:
- Trench backfill
- Landscaping
- Site grading
- Utility projects
This makes screening buckets a vital part of screening buckets material applications on construction sites.
Sand and Gravel
Sand and gravel recovered from excavation or demolition can be screened to achieve uniform sizing.
Using screening buckets allows contractors to:
- Remove oversized material
- Improve compaction performance
- Reuse material immediately
Processed sand and gravel are ideal for:
- Backfill
- Bedding layers
- Drainage applications
Clay and Cohesive Materials
Clay-heavy soils can be difficult to manage, but screening buckets help break down clumps and remove contaminants.
Screened clay material is easier to compact and more predictable in performance, especially in trench backfill applications.
Wood and Organic Debris Separation
Although bucket crushers are not designed to crush wood, screening buckets play an important role in separating organic material from mineral content.
By removing wood, roots, and organic debris, contractors improve the quality of reusable material and avoid contamination in backfill or road base.

Matching the Right Tool to the Material
Not every material requires crushing. Understanding when to use a bucket crusher versus a screening bucket is key.
- Use bucket crushers for size reduction of hard materials
- Use screening buckets for separation and material refinement
- Combine both for maximum efficiency
